Registered dietitian-nutritionist Cheshire Que shares easy-to-follow and doable tips to keep high-blood sugar at bay.
• Be active. The American Diabetes Association recommends 30 minutes of moderate to vigorous aerobic exercises at least five times a week. When you’re active and constantly moving, it helps lower blood glucose levels.
• Take control of your plate. The key to a healthy eating plan is to fill up your plate with vegetables, fruits and whole grains. “Moderation and meal-timing are the keys to regulate blood sugar. It’s also important to space out your mealtime regularly to prevent your blood sugar level from dropping too low, a condition we call hypoglycemia, which often leads to shaking, weakness, dizziness, and sometimes seizures,” Que said.
• Rest from stress. Knowing how to effectively manage your stressors will not only help improve your mood, but it will also boost your immunity to overall wellness. “Sleep is a vital part of stress management because it gives our body a chance to recuperate and repair body organs. Not only will it enhance your focus and clear your mind, it will also put you in a better mood,” Cheshire added.
The National Sleep Foundation recommends seven to nine hours of sleep for adults, but if you’re having trouble drifting off, make downtime part of your routine — dim the lights, slightly decrease your room’s thermostat, and turn off your mobile or tablet.
